there was a tear in her
coat pocket and
nickles
and
quarters
and
keys
fell out leaving a trail of
lost items behind
she wondered if there
might be a similar tear
in her brain trailing
names
and
dates
and
recent
memories
the pocket could be
patched but she wasn’t
so sure
about
the
brain
